Importance of OPD
The Outpatient Department (OPD) at Swami Vivekananda Medical Mission Charitable Hospital plays a crucial role in our gastroenterology services. OPD provides patients with the opportunity to receive care without the need for hospitalization, ensuring convenience and accessibility.
Key Benefits of OPD Services:
Accessibility: Patients can easily schedule appointments and receive timely care, reducing waiting times for treatments and consultations.
Preventive Care: Regular check-ups and screenings help in the early detection of GI disorders, leading to more effective treatment outcomes.
Continuity of Care: OPD facilitates ongoing monitoring of chronic conditions, allowing our specialists to make necessary adjustments to treatment plans as needed.
Patient Education: We believe in empowering our patients through education about their conditions, treatment options, and lifestyle changes that can aid in their recovery.
Services Offered in OPD
Our Gastroenterology OPD offers a comprehensive range of services, including:
Consultations: Patients can meet with our gastroenterologists for evaluations, diagnoses, and treatment planning. Initial consultations focus on understanding the patient's medical history, symptoms, and lifestyle factors.
Follow-Up Care: Ongoing monitoring and management of chronic conditions ensure that patients receive the necessary adjustments to their treatment as they progress.
Nutritional Counseling: Our team provides dietary guidance tailored to specific GI conditions, promoting optimal digestive health.
Lifestyle Modification Programs: We offer support for weight management, smoking cessation, and other lifestyle changes that can positively impact digestive health.
